PDP Names Amina Arong as New National Woman Leader

The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) has appointed Amina Arong from Cross River State as the new National Woman Leader, following the passing of Prof Stella Effah-Attoe in October 2023.

Prof Stella Effah-Attoe, a member of the PDP National Working Committee, passed away after a brief illness. The party has now selected Amina Arong, who holds a Diploma in Banking and Finance and a B.Sc. in Accounting, to complete the remaining term of Effah-Attoe.

In a statement by the National Publicity Secretary, Debo Ologunagba, the PDP expressed satisfaction with Arong’s intellectual capacity, experience, competence, and vigor in mobilizing women for the party at both state and national levels. The party commended Arong’s longstanding commitment to the PDP, acknowledging her leading roles in mobilizing women and youth groups and conducting party primaries and congresses across the country.

The PDP congratulated Amina Arong and urged her to use her capacity and experience to collaborate with other members of the National Working Committee, ensuring the continued stability, growth, and success of the party.
